Polish artist Tamara de Lempicka nicknamed "The Baroness with a Brush" was known for her stylish artwork & self-portraits oozing feminine power, sensuality & liberation of the 1920s women. She also dabbled in abstract work using a palette knife. #stationery #abstractartist
